Vue 渐进式的理解
生活随笔
收集整理的這篇文章主要介紹了
Vue 渐进式的理解
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
前言:
突然有一天有人問你:"Vue的漸進式如何理解?", 雖然是平時經常在用但說真的很難用簡短的話語講述給不了解的同學,今天將我的對其概述的見解分享給大家。
是什么?
官網:Vue是一套用于構建用戶界面的漸進式框架
從上述的話語中我們可以提煉出兩個信息,1個是Vue是用于開發界面的(相當于廢話主要是為引入第2個信息);2是一個漸進式的框架;想到這大家可能有點蒙-‘如何理解漸進式這個名詞呢’。。。其實是從使用vue的方式上面來進行的定義的即: 聲明式渲染->組件化應用->客戶端路由->集中式狀態管理->項目構建
聲明式渲染:
// 引入vue
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
// html
<div id="app">
{{ msg }}
</div>
// js
<script>
var app = new Vue({
el: '#app',
data: {
msg: 'Hello Vue!'
}
})
</script>
組件化應用
可將上述每個聲明式的方式的文件當成一個組件,一個項目中可有多個組件相互構成,盜用官網上的一張圖來說明
客戶端路由: 通過使用其路由的特性實現單頁面應用
集中式狀態管理: 也就是vue中的vuex的概念
項目構建: 這一般是一個在大型的項目中由開發,打包,部署,上線等流程
漸進式總結: 從使用vue的方式上來進行區分定義的,也可以單獨使用vue中的api,也可以使用vue中的底層服務,所以也可以這么說vue即是庫又是框架。
謝謝客官的品嘗,如有不嚴謹和錯誤地方請希望指正,祝大家工作和生活順利 !
總結
以上是生活随笔為你收集整理的Vue 渐进式的理解的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 视差贴图(Parallax Mappin
- 下一篇: python应用之求主析取范式,主合取范